Neuroscience and Critique is a ground-breaking edited collection which considers the impact of neuroscience on contemporary social science and the humanities. Bringing together leading scholars from several disciplines, the contributors draw upon a range of perspectives.
Author Biography
Jan De Vos is a post-doctoral FWO Research Fellow at the Centre for Critical Philosophy of Ghent University, Belgium. His main research area is that of the neurological turn and its implications for ideology critique.
Ed Pluth is professor and chair of the philosophy department at California State University, Chico, USA. He works on issues and figures in contemporary continental philosophy, with special attention to how language and the extra-linguistic are put into relation to each other, and what this relation implies generally about the status of thinking and conscious life.
